Transaction 62f399ce8d0f26130dfc5875d69d61c74756ab637e69739e16bf49645087ae27

1 Input
2 Outputs
  • 62f399ce8d0f26130dfc5875d69d61c74756ab637e69739e16bf49645087ae27:0
  • value  1502646000
    address  18ovH25GN6uCBw8HJiA5XGn9KY9Ctk1sTV
  • 62f399ce8d0f26130dfc5875d69d61c74756ab637e69739e16bf49645087ae27:1
  • value  16000
    address  1Hbwfhu384jk8HcxtwncwqCyQhz2adZSk1